|  | /// Test whether MI is a child of some other node in an expression tree. | 
|  | bool WebAssembly::isChild(const MachineInstr &MI, | 
|  | const WebAssemblyFunctionInfo &MFI) { | 
|  | if (MI.getNumOperands() == 0) | 
|  | return false; | 
|  | const MachineOperand &MO = MI.getOperand(0); | 
|  | if (!MO.isReg() || MO.isImplicit() || !MO.isDef()) | 
|  | return false; | 
|  | unsigned Reg = MO.getReg(); | 
|  | return TargetRegisterInfo::isVirtualRegister(Reg) && | 
|  | MFI.isVRegStackified(Reg); | 
|  | } |

|  | MachineBasicBlock *llvm::LoopBottom(const MachineLoop *Loop) { | 
|  | MachineBasicBlock *Bottom = Loop->getHeader(); | 
|  | for (MachineBasicBlock *MBB : Loop->blocks()) | 
|  | if (MBB->getNumber() > Bottom->getNumber()) | 
|  | Bottom = MBB; | 
|  | return Bottom; | 
|  | } |
